Position: Account Executive, Sports & Live Entertainment

Cast & Crew is looking for a high‑energy, field‑driven Account Executive to grow revenue across our Live Entertainment division. This quota‑carrying individual contributor focuses on winning new relationships and expanding existing ones across Touring and Venues & Festivals.

Key Qualifications
  • Deep familiarity with live entertainment production ecosystems, including touring operations, venue management, festival production, and the production services companies that support them.
  • Experience working with or selling to touring managers, production managers, venue operations leaders, festival producers, or the production services firms that crew and support live events.
  • Proven ability to build relationships that generate revenue across multiple tours, seasons, and events, not just one‑time transactions.
  • Comfortable with a faster deal cadence and the ability to manage a high‑volume pipeline with multiple opportunities at different stages simultaneously.
  • A presence in the live entertainment community; you show up, you’re known, and you know how to work a room at an industry event or conference.
  • Strong pipeline discipline with the ability to forecast accurately against seasonal production calendars and touring cycles.
  • Familiarity with Hub Spot.
What You’ll Do
  • Own an individual revenue target spanning new logo acquisition and expansion of existing production services, touring, and venue relationships.
  • Build and maintain a strong presence across the live entertainment ecosystem, developing trusted relationships with touring managers, production managers, venue operations leaders, festival producers, and the production services companies that support them.
  • Move fast and stay ahead of the calendar, identifying upcoming tours, festival seasons, and venue productions early enough to position Cast & Crew before decisions are locked.
  • Take a consultative approach with clients, connecting their crew payroll, workforce management, and production support challenges to Cast & Crew’s solutions in a way that speaks the language of live entertainment.
  • Manage a high‑velocity pipeline with clear visibility across deal stages, seasonal timelines, and revenue timing, keeping forecast accuracy tight even as opportunities move quickly.
  • Be on the ground where it matters, representing Cast & Crew at industry conferences, touring industry events, venue summits, festival gatherings, and sponsorship activations where live entertainment relationships are built and maintained.
  • Identify expansion opportunities within existing production services accounts, uncovering new tours, new venues, or new divisions that haven’t yet engaged with Cast & Crew.
  • Partner with Operations, Customer Success, and Finance to ensure a smooth onboarding experience and strong service delivery from contract through production close.
  • Bring market intelligence back to the business, surfacing competitive dynamics, seasonal trends, and client feedback that sharpen Cast & Crew’s positioning in the live entertainment space.
What You’ll Bring
  • 3 to 6 years of experience in a quota‑carrying sales, business development, or strategic account role within live entertainment, touring, venue operations, production services, or a closely related field.
  • A track record of consistent revenue attainment across both new business and account expansion in a fast‑moving, seasonally driven environment.
  • Experience navigating multi‑stakeholder buying environments where decisions involve touring managers, production companies, venue leadership, and finance teams simultaneously.
  • Strong consultative selling and negotiation skills; you lead with knowledge of their world, not just a product pitch.
  • Genuine comfort with a high‑activity, high‑velocity sales motion; you thrive when the pace is fast and the calendar is driving urgency.
  • An existing presence or network in the live entertainment, touring, or production services community that you can activate from day one.
  • Willingness to travel and be in the field regularly; this role is built around being where the industry is, not just working from behind a desk.
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ent professional experience.
